Current results range from 1835 to 1863
Master record for Schaaf no. 2966
Location: Swansea
Master record for Schaaf no. 3381
Master record for Schaaf no. 2610
Created: 23 Aug 1841
Master record for Schaaf no. 5364
Master record for Schaaf no. 1929
Location: Paris
Master record for Schaaf no. 2031
Master record for Schaaf no. 2032
Master record for Schaaf no. 531
Master record for Schaaf no. 5015
Master record for Schaaf no. 515